Treadmills Sale - How to Find the Best Deals on Treadmills
Since the outbreak, treadmills have become popular as a home exercise option for those who prefer to stay at their homes. Look for features such as built-in workout applications or a variety of different incline levels.
Brands like NordicTrack, LifeSpan and more offer top-quality treadmills. Shop a range of sizes and prices to meet your budget and exercise needs.
Space Saver Design
Whether bad weather or expensive gym memberships keep you away from regular workouts having a treadmill sale at home makes it easier to keep your fitness. These treadmills are small and easy to store making them a great supplement to any home workout routine.
However, when it comes to choosing an efficient treadmill for your house, there are many things to take into consideration. You'll have to think about how often you intend to use the treadmill. If you're just starting out and plan to take a leisurely stroll or power walk, a low-cost folding treadmill for home might be the best option for you. On the other the other hand, if your an avid runner who wants to prepare for marathons and road races, look for higher-end treadmills for sale near me that can support heavier use.
If you're looking to exercise while at work The LifeSpan Fitness TR1200-DT3 Under Desk Treadmill is a great choice. It is designed to let you work and walk simultaneously. It is able to be easily rolled underneath your desk.
If you're looking for treadmills that fold flat for easy storage under your bed or in a closet, there are many models to choose from. But, you should be aware that these treadmills typically have a smaller deck and are less functional than treadmills that are upright. They are also lighter and more unstable, particularly when you are running on them.
Take into consideration the power of the motor, particularly if you plan on running regularly. The majority of treadmills that fold can only handle moderate speeds. However, more powerful machines are capable of higher speeds and even incline running. Also you should look for a console that provides clear and precise readings of your workout performance data such as distance traveled and calories burned. Some of the most expensive treadmills come with features such as Bluetooth connectivity, a touchscreen and 30 pre-programmed workouts.
Speed Range
Treadmills are a great way to stay in shape indoors. For some, this is more convenient than running outside. They can also assist people to keep their fitness goals regardless of weather or other issues prevent them from working out. The most effective treadmills for sale will have a quality motor, a range of speeds to choose from, such as running, walking and jogging. They also have an incline feature that lets users to simulate declines and hills during their workouts. Look for displays with touchscreens and workout apps with integrated into the design and are compact.
Treadmill sales typically revolve around New Years, as many people make resolutions to get fitter for the year ahead. They can also happen at other times of the year. If you're not certain when to buy the best price on a treadmill for your home, keep an eye out for sales that are particularly popular during holidays such as Thanksgiving, Black Friday and Cyber Monday. The manufacturers of treadmills are also eager to beat out their competition in these shopping periods, so they often provide the best prices of the year.
There are a variety of treadmills for sale in the $500-$1,000 range. The treadmills in this price range usually have top speeds of up to 8 or 10 miles per hour (MPH) which is equivalent to 7:30 or 15:30 5K run. They also have smaller motor ratings, which is typically 2.2 continuous horsepower or less.
As you advance in the price range, speed and horsepower increase too. As low as $2,000 can get you an exercise machine that can run 12 MPH. This can be enough to run a 5 minute mile or a 10-minute 5K. There are treadmills that offer higher incline options, including some with up to 15% of incline and others that can decrease.
Before you make a purchase look up reviews on various treadmill models. It's helpful to see what other people think of the treadmill you're contemplating, and you may find some helpful information that you didn't know about before.

Special Features
Treadmills let exercisers work out in their homes, which can help them avoid the hurdles that can keep them from getting fit such as bad weather and expensive gym memberships. Be sure that the treadmills you're considering have features such as drink holders or storage areas for smartphones and tablets. Some models have built-in speakers, fans, and even workout applications that enhance motivation.
The amount of horsepower delivered by the motor is also an important factor to consider. It will affect how powerful and smooth the machine is. A more expensive treadmill could come with an engine that produces up to 3.0 continuous-duty horsepower. The size of the belt is an important factor too. It will affect how comfortable it is to run or walk and how long you can comfortably support your body weight.
Some treadmills also offer a variety of display options, like LCD or LED screens. The former is more prevalent, but isn't always easy to see under certain lighting conditions. This is especially the case when you're exercising at night. The latter is more expensive, and has a more brightness and is easier to read.
While running is the primary purpose of many treadmills, certain models are designed for walking. These treadmills have a smaller deck, and usually have lower weight capacities and less built-in console features than the running models. They can provide an excellent jogging or walking workout however they aren't as advanced as the running models.
Design and ergonomics are important features that make a Treadmill Sale appealing. Try each model before you purchase. Make sure to determine whether the unit shakes, or sounds quiet when you use it. Find a sturdy frame and a console that's easy to look at. If you are shopping for a treadmill that is intended for home use, check the dimensions to ensure it will fit in your space, and whether or not you'll need to put it together prior to using.
